I recently acquired a 2500 gram normal female and noticed yesterday that she had her mid section and lower body upside down, exposing her belly. She was curled in a ball while doing this. Her top 1/3 of her body including her head were in normal posture and she is soaking in her water dish this morning (or at least trying to fit her big body in it). First year working with balls, but I'm guessing this is breeding behavior???

It could also be your snake is about shed. My snakes sometime do that when they are about to shed

Chances are she's just tryin to get comfy. Both of my males lay like that, sometimes with their entire body sideways, so that they actually look pretty dead. First time I saw them doing that I just about had a heart attack.
